indication

英 [ɪndɪ'keɪʃ(ə)n] 美[,ɪndɪ'keʃən]
  • n. 指示,指出;迹象;象征

英英释意


1. something that serves to indicate or suggest;
"an indication of foul play"
"indications of strain"
"symptoms are the prime indicants of disease"
2. the act of indicating or pointing out by name
3. (medicine) a reason to prescribe a drug or perform a procedure;
"the presence of bacterial infection was an indication for the use of antibiotics"
4. something (as a course of action) that is indicated as expedient or necessary;
"there were indications that it was time to leave"
5. a datum about some physical state that is presented to a user by a meter or similar instrument;
"he could not believe the meter reading"
"the barometer gave clear indications of an approaching storm"
